PTAC 1410 - Process Technology I Equipment

Credits 4 Lecture Hours 3 Lab Hours 2
Instruction in the use of common process equipment. This course builds on the information presented in previous courses putting the components of equipment together. Students will apply the knowledge taught in previous courses to understand how individual equipment work, how they interconnect, and how they contribute to overall plant operations. The student will arrange process equipment into basic systems; describe the purpose and function of specific process equipment; explain how factors affecting process equipment are controlled under normal conditions; and recognize abnormal process conditions. This course covers the petroleum refining industry and petrochemical industry equipment. Corequisite: PTAC 1302 . Course Identifier 41.0301 TEC
